2 serving of green eggs contains 445 Calories. The macronutrient breakdown is 9% carbs, 62% fat, and 29% protein. This is a good source of protein (58% of your Daily Value), potassium (20% of your Daily Value), and vitamin a (105% of your Daily Value).

Directions
- Mix eggs and greens in a food processor until smooth. Melt coconut oil in a skillet over medium heat. Pour egg mixture into pan and cook. Scramble eggs to desired doneness and serve immediately. Enjoy!
